KSIAZENICKI, Mariana et al. Respiratory follow-up of patients with COVID-19 pneumonia after hospital discharge: experience at a uruguayan centre. Rev. Méd. Urug. [online]. 2026, vol.42, n.2, e201. Epub 27-Abr-2026. ISSN 0303-3295. https://doi.org/10.29193/rmu.42.2.6.
Introduction:
Viral pneumonitis is the main cause of hospital admission in patients with COVID-19. Timely post-discharge follow-up should be performed to diagnose and manage the main respiratory complications.
Objective:
To describe the clinical, radiological, and functional follow-up after hospital discharge for COVID-19 pneumonitis.
Materials and methods:
Observational, analytical, retrospective study. Hospitalised patients from January to July 2021 with a discharge diagnosis of COVID-19 pneumonitis were included. Follow-up was conducted both by telephone and in person, including clinical, imaging, and spirometric assessment in those with dyspnoea and/or abnormal imaging at 8 weeks after discharge.
Results:
n=590 patients, 355 men. Age: 52±14 (mean±SD) years. Comorbidities: hypertension (34%), obesity (18%), chronic respiratory diseases (17%), diabetes (16%), smoking (12%). Admission to the intensive care unit n=73 (12%); high-flow oxygen therapy n=52 (9%), non-invasive mechanical ventilation n=19 (3%), and invasive mechanical ventilation n=14 (2%). Eleven percent developed severe disease. Obesity/overweight was significantly associated with severe disease (OR 2.33; 95% CI 1.32–4.10; p=0.004). Severe disease was associated with a higher likelihood of discharge with home oxygen (OR 2.05; 95% CI 1.19–3.53; p=0.008). Twenty-three percent required oxygen therapy at discharge. Corticosteroid therapy for more than 10 days: n=119 (20%). At 4–8 weeks, 62% had persistent symptoms, with dyspnoea being the most frequent (24%). At 4–12 weeks, 31% showed persistent radiological abnormalities. Eighteen percent (n=33) of spirometry tests performed were abnormal, with a predominance of a restrictive pattern (28/33).
Conclusions:
A significant proportion of patients hospitalised for COVID-19 pneumonia presented clinical, radiological, and functional respiratory sequelae during post-discharge follow-up. Initial severity and obesity/overweight were associated with worse outcomes. These results support the implementation of structured respiratory follow-up programmes in this population.
